Caulfield Cup Winner Fraar Dies
The 1993 Gr Caulfield Cup winner Fraar (Topsider-Alchaasibiyeh, by Seattle Slew) has died at Cornerstone Stud, aged 24, where he has been living in retirement. Bred by Sheikh Hamdan bin Rashid Al Maktoum's Shadwell Stud, the Royal Ascot winner was also placed in the Gr1 C.F.Orr Stakes, Gr1 Mackinnon Stakes & Gr1 Australian Cup, in addition to winning the Gr3 Coongy Stakes & a few Listed events. Fraar is the sire of 7 stakes-winners including the gifted sprinter-miler Nina Haraka, and winners in 9 countries, however his legacy in years to come may be as a broodmare sire; he is the broodmare sire of such performers as The Verminator and Snitzerland, who set a new track record in Sydney over the weekend (see full report below).
